The Spectrum of the Spectrum – Estimating Bed Thickness with Cepstral Decomposition
- Publisher: European Association of Geoscientists & Engineers
- Source: Conference Proceedings, 67th EAGE Conference & Exhibition, Jun 2005, cp-1-00440
Abstract
P298 The spectrum of the spectrum: estimating bed thickness with cepstral decomposition Abstract 1 This paper shows that the Fourier transform of the amplitude spectrum of a seismic trace can provide an accurate measure of bedding thickness in the subsurface. Given the recent emergence of spectral decomposition as a widespread seismic interpretation tool this related technique could help reduce uncertainty because it is a robust way to extract quantitative information from the amplitude spectrum.
